Non-Profit and Private School Notice
Non-profit private schools and home schools, within the Hill County Shared Services Arrangement, that legally qualify as non-profit (currently hold a 501(C)(3) certificate), have the opportunity to participate in federally funded programs administered by the district. Qualifying schools may contact Cherish Hermes, Special Education Director at 254-582-3814, to learn more about the federally funded services available for eligible residents. A meeting will take place on August 23, 2023 at the Hill County Shared Services Arrangement building at 200 Line Street, Hillsboro, TX 76645.
The Texas Transition and Employment Guide can help students with disabilities to plan for adult life. You can begin planning while students are still in school. Use this guide to find out what to expect and where to find help.
